Prosecutors sought a heavy sentence for a former police officer who deceived a construction company chair into believing the officer could block a prosecution investigation, then took cash and luxury foreign cars worth about 1 billion won. The former officer fled before a detention warrant hearing and was later caught at a golf course.

At the sentencing hearing on the 15th before the 14th criminal division of the Suwon District Court, presided over by Director General Judge Yoon Seong-yeol, prosecutors asked the court to sentence former police officer A to 15 years in prison on charges including fraud under the Act on the Aggravated Punishment, etc. of Specific Economic Crimes. Prosecutors also said they would seek confiscation of the Mercedes-Benz vehicle A received from the victim.

A's side admitted all charges and pleaded for leniency. In the final argument, the attorney said, "We are ashamed that the accomplices kept shifting blame to one another," and added, "As responsibility was being passed around, we neglected to compensate the victim, but if given a chance, we will do everything to restore the damage."

In a final statement, A said, "Because I am a person with nothing to show, I had a habit of puffing myself up and deluded myself into thinking I was someone important," and added, "I deeply apologize to the victim and will do my best to be forgiven."

A was indicted along with accomplice B, a former Vice Administrator of the Korean National Police Agency, on charges of stealing 1 billion won in cash and a foreign car worth 265 million won from construction company chair C. They was found to have pretended to be close to powerful figures, including incumbent prosecutors, judges, and politicians, in connection with an embezzlement complaint case involving C.

A was found to have told C, "I will exert pressure to reach a settlement," deceiving C into believing the investigation could be quashed.

There was also a getaway during the investigation. On Jan. 14, when a detention warrant was sought, A did not appear for the pretrial detention hearing and went into hiding. A then alternated among mobile phones under other people's names and frequently swapped SIM cards to evade investigative tracking.

The fugitive life ended after a little over two months. In Mar., A was arrested and indicted in custody while playing golf with a spouse at a golf course in Eumseong, North Chungcheong.

The same sentence was sought for accomplice B. At B's sentencing hearing on the 8th, prosecutors asked the court to impose 15 years in prison.
